Hello all. First post here. I've been lurking here for some time. I've finally found the courage to post. I'm 32, been struggling for some time with alcohol, and I think I am finally ready to give it up. I'm writing this to try to keep myself accountable to it. Don't really have much of a plan yet, just taking it a day at a time. Just reading all the posts on here have been a great help and encouragement so far. I'm on day 2, which usually isn't that hard for me to get this far, I know it will be challenging this weekend, but I think I can get through it. Anyway, just wanted to say hello. Thanks

Thanks everyone for being so welcoming. So far so good this weekend. Saturday is probably the toughest day of the week for me, but I am pretty sure I can get through it. One thing I have noticed, I'm not very social with my wife at night, she keeps asking me if I am okay. I guess I feel pretty irritable at night too. Sleep doesn't seem real refreshing, and I am pretty tired today.
I can't really just take it easy even on the weekends. I have a day job and I raise livestock, not much for spare time. I am going to try to make a post a day and hopefully that will help me along.
